These were wet/electrolyte reproduction Delco licensed R-59 E-5000 2900 watts @ 0° top post Batterys that I cut the bottoms out of and removed all the guts inside.The side walls are full of Delco-eyes and a dead on match to the original.Each one has been neutralized with baking soda.
This would make a nice display in a correct stock car,that is carrying an incorrect battery,or drag racers can insert a smaller cell battery inside to save on weight while participating in a stock appearing drag race as well.
